当前位置:当前位置: 首页 >
kafka如何解决重复消费?_山西省忻州市忻府区微闭扩竹木有限公司
浏览次数:304发表时间:2025-06-20 07:35:15
先说重复消费现象的成因,再说可选的解决方案。
一. Kafka 重复消费的产生原因生产端和消费端均有可以导致重复消费的场景。
1.1 生产过程产生重复消息生产者发出一条消息,Broker 正常存储该消息,但之后有可能因为各种因素未正常响应生产者(比如网络问题、Broker宕机等等)。
此时,若生产者不想冒消息丢失的风险,那它将只有一个选择:重试。
当 Broker 将该消息正常存储后,Kafka 中便有了两条重复的消息,进而引发消费端多次…。
同类文章排行
- 媒体称以色列防空成本一晚近 3 亿美元,最多再撑 12 天,美方会支援吗?若无美补给结果会如何?
- 能够自己一个人创业的全栈web码农fullstack developer要会哪些技术?
- JetBrains 放弃 AppCode 是否是一个错误决定?
- 为什么黄毛骗走的都是乖乖女?
- 初三画成这样算是有天赋吗?【正经求助】?
- 自己组一个E5服务器才几百块钱,为什么去阿里云租这么贵?
- 跨平台GUI框架到底应该自绘还是原生控件绑定?
- 苹果为什么要给每代MacOS起个名字,真以为人们记得住分得清吗?
- 为什么苹果手机杀后台现象频繁?是内存不够、后台管理严格还是其他原因呢?
- 如果战争爆发,中国普通老百姓枪都不会打该怎样自卫?
最新资讯文章
- 小米YU7从7月提前至6月底发布,是什么原因导致提前发布?
- flutter为什么不用Go语言,而用Dart?
- 小米汽车官方解释了刹车盘生锈属于正常现象,并提供了两种除锈功能,这些措施是否足够有效?
- 山西晋城举全城之力引入摇滚演唱会,两天接待近 6 万乐迷,一场成功的演唱会能给城市带来怎样的收益?
- 马上领证了,发现男朋友离不了游戏,让他少打游戏他会非常生气,正常吗?
- 奥迪暂停全面电动化***,不再设定停售燃油车时间表,此前沃尔沃、奔驰也调整全面电动化***,如何解读?
- 广州的公共交通为什么这么烂?
- 西方人是怎么发现地球是圆的的?
- 老饭骨做的饭真的好吃吗 ?
- 男子蛋糕被小女孩踩坏,上前理论还被其家长辱骂殴打,如果发生这种事情有比***里当事人更好的处理方法吗?
- Gemini 2.5 Flash 和Pro稳定版上线,和之前版本相比,在性能和应用场景上有哪些提升?
- 能分享一下你写过的rust项目吗?
- 《明朝那些事儿》的作者当年明月疯了,疯了就可以摆脱烦恼了吗?
- 有性瘾女朋友每天都要很多遍要不要分手?
- Rust开发Web后端效率如何?
- 如何看待当今小学生的疯狂内卷?
- 大家为什么会讨厌缩写?
- 为什么个人需要公网ip?
- 巅峰期的成龙身体素质是怎么一种存在?
- 如何评价中国电科研发的JY-10防空指挥控制系统成为伊朗防空指挥系统核心?